Clemson has been locked into its priority inside linebacker target for the duration of the calendar year.

Paramus (N.J.) Catholic four-star linebacker Drew Singleton returns to campus for the third time this year as a headlining visitor for the Tigers’ “All-In Cookout” Friday night.

“I feel like the two visits were thorough, so I’ve really seen everything,” Singleton said. “So there’s not anything I haven’t really seen. But each visit still has been an eye-opener. It’s always been a great time. I still get goose bumps when I walk into the stadium.”

Singleton (6-2, 215), ranked No. 39 nationally by Rivals.com, holds offers from Alabama, Auburn, Georgia, LSU, Michigan, Michigan State, Notre Dame, Ohio State, Penn State, Tennessee and others.

He visited Clemson with his father and uncle for an extended weekend in late January in conjunction with the program’s elite junior day.

Singleton then returned with his mother and father for a long weekend to see Clemson’s spring game in April.
